Course Content

• Introduction to Mathematical Induction: Fundamentals and Applications
• Proof Techniques in Mathematical Induction: Direct Proof and Strong Induction
• Mathematical Induction and Recursive Definitions: Exploring their Interplay
• Advanced Applications of Mathematical Induction: Solving Recurrence Relations
• Mathematical Induction and Combinatorics: Counting and Probability Applications
• Induction and Algorithm Analysis: Proving Algorithm Correctness
• Logical Fallacies in Induction Proofs: Avoiding Common Mistakes
• Induction in Number Theory: Prime Numbers and Divisibility
• Case Studies in Mathematical Induction: Real-World Examples
